For many years, the main focus of energy-efficient lighting was merely minimizing the amount of electricity consumed. This caused the widespread adoption of Compact Fluorescent Lamps, which, while effective, typically produced a severe, flickering light that numerous found unpleasant. The transition to Light Emitting Diode innovation has actually resolved these visual issues while using even greater energy cost savings. LED systems are now the gold standard for both residential and business electrical services due to their longevity and versatility. An LED bulb can last approximately 50,000 hours, which is considerably longer than the 1,000-hour life-span of a conventional incandescent bulb. This durability is especially important in commercial settings with high ceilings where the labor expense of replacing a single bulb can be significant.
When picking lighting for a home, the focus is typically on "atmosphere" and "heat." Residential areas take advantage of lighting with a lower color temperature level, usually determined in between 2700K and 3000K on the Kelvin scale. This produces a soft, yellow-colored radiance that imitates standard halogen bulbs and promotes a sense of relaxation. In a home environment, dimmability is likewise a high top priority. Modern residential LED setups permit smooth dimming transitions, allowing a kitchen to move from a bright, functional work space during meal preparation to a controlled, ambient environment for evening dining. Property owners ought to also consider "CRI" or Color Rendering Index; a high CRI ensures that the colors of furnishings, food, and clothes appear natural and dynamic under synthetic light.
In contrast, industrial lighting environments prioritize "performance" and "harmony." Offices and retail spaces normally utilize a higher color temperature, normally between 4000K and 5000K. This "cool white" or "daytime" spectrum is developed to imitate natural sunshine, which assists to reduce melatonin production and keep employees alert and focused throughout work hours. In commercial settings, the design of the lighting is just as important as the bulbs themselves. An expert electrician will typically carry out a "lumen estimation" to ensure that the light is distributed equally throughout all workstations, avoiding the glare and shadows that can result in eye strain and headaches.
For businesses, the choice of lighting typically extends into the world of clever controls. Industrial residential or commercial properties often use "harvesting" sensors that spot the quantity of natural light entering through windows and instantly dim the internal lights to compensate. Occupancy sensors are another staple of energy-saving business electrical services, ensuring that corridors, restrooms, and storage areas are just brightened when someone is in fact present. These automated systems can lower a building's lighting-related energy usage by an extra thirty to forty percent beyond the cost savings offered by the LED bulbs themselves.
One area where home and workplace requirements are beginning to converge is in the application of "Circadian Lighting" or human-centric lighting. This technology permits the color temperature level of the lights to change immediately throughout the day. In the early morning, the lights discharge a crisp, blue-toned white to help occupants wake up and focus. As evening techniques, the system slowly shifts to a warmer, amber tone to prepare the body for sleep. While this was once a high-end luxury, it is progressively being installed in Melbourne office and forward-thinking corporate headquarters to improve the psychological health and sleep quality of occupants who spend get more info the majority of their day indoors.
From a technical perspective, the hardware used in these 2 environments can differ significantly. House frequently use "downlights" or pendant components that are designed to be aesthetically pleasing. Business homes, however, often use "troffers" or direct high-bay lights that are developed for optimal output and ease of upkeep in a grid ceiling. Regardless of the component type, it is essential to make sure that all elements work with the existing wiring. This is why involving a professional electrician during the choice procedure is so important. They can verify that brand-new LED motorists will not trigger disturbance with other electronic devices which the dimming switches are compatible with the particular brand of LED being set up.
Lastly, the financial aspect of selecting energy-saving lighting can not be overlooked. While the upfront cost of high-quality LED fixtures and clever sensors is higher than conventional options, the roi is frequently realized in less than 2 years through lowered energy bills and lower upkeep costs. In many regions, there are likewise federal government refunds and incentives available for companies that upgrade to energy-efficient lighting, more sweetening the deal.
